Defining Physical Options for Individual Objects

You can set physical options for selected objects to override the default physical options.

Note:

You can choose a tablespace or storage already defined in the model as a value for a tablespace or storage that you define for a table. These are listed in a list below the right pane in the Options tab. In DB2 OS/390, tablespaces are, by default, prefixed by the name of the database attached to the model (see DBMS-Specific Features).
